How to contour your cheekbones with self tanner

2 Min Read Tuesday 19th March 2019

Slash your make up routine in half by using fake tan to contour your cheekbones. It’s dead easy, takes about five minutes and the results last for up to 7 days.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Prep your face by removing all traces of make up. A quick cleanse will get rid of any residue left your skin, leaving behind a smooth surface for your tanner to evenly cling on to.
  2. Pump a small amount of One Hour Self Tan Tinted Lotion onto a cotton pad or a tanning mitt and grab a stiff make up brush. Dip the tip of the brush into the tanner, suck in your cheeks and apply a line of product along the hollows of your cheekbones (this video will show you how). Gently buff the tanner in and blend it along the edges to create a soft line that gently fades up towards the cheeks. You can use your fingers to encourage an even blend but make sure you wash your hands immediately afterwards to prevent them staining.
  3. Wait an hour before washing your face and patting your skin dry (your glow will gently develop over the course of the day) Follow up with a rich moisturiser to lock in your colour and encourage your new contour to last as long as a week, both day and night!
